Across Canada, too many people are still not getting the care they need.

Wait times for surgeries and specialist care remain too long. Significant gaps remain in access to community-based arthritis programs. Critical health data is still not consistently collected or reported. Arthritis research is underfunded, awarded less than 2% of investment from Canada’s largest federal funder of health research.

Incremental change is not delivering the progress Canadians need.

About Arthritis Society Canada

Arthritis Society Canada represents the more than six million people in Canada living with arthritis today, and the millions more who are impacted or at risk. Fueled by the trust and support of our donors and volunteers, Arthritis Society Canada is fighting arthritis with research, advocacy, innovation, information and support. We are Canada’s largest charitable funder of cutting-edge arthritis research. We will not give up our efforts until everyone is free from the agony of arthritis.
